Morning air moves through a garage with the door rolled up, sunlight hitting the concrete floor and the workbench along the wall. A man stands there in a short-sleeve shirt, checking a project spread out in front of him. The air carries a bright bergamot note that feels like the natural lift of the day, clean and immediate. Cedar sits beneath it, dry and straight, giving the space a grounded, wooden character that matches the surroundings. Amber adds a soft, powdery warmth that keeps the air from feeling sharp. It is an aromatic profile that fits the room without trying to dominate it.
The scent stays close to the skin, moving with the person rather than filling the entire space. It feels practical and unpretentious, a straightforward composition that does not rely on heavy tricks or dramatic shifts. The citrus remains present, the wood stays dry, and the amber provides a gentle, powdery finish that reads as classic rather than modern. There is a simplicity here that works in a familiar environment where the focus is on the task at hand, not on the fragrance itself.
This is a good match for a man who spends his daylight hours in casual, active settings and wants a clean, woody citrus that behaves well. Wear it during spring, summer, and fall mornings while working, walking, or running errands in the sun.
